The Mortgage Corner with GreenState Credit Union: Understanding Mortgage Rates—Key Factors and Influences

Mortgage rates, in simple terms, are the interest rates applied to home loans, and they play a critical role in determining how affordable a home is. Understanding what influences mortgage rates can help you make more informed decisions.

Factors You Can’t Control

1. Economic Conditions
Mortgage rates are deeply tied to the overall economy. In a strong economy, mortgage rates tend to rise, while weaker economic conditions often cause rates to fall. Economic events worldwide have a significant impact on these rates, so it's crucial to stay updated on global financial trends. Bloomberg Markets offers insights on these global shifts.

Market Value Vs. Appraised Value

Sunday, May 28th, 2023 at 9:00am.
Oakridge Real Estate

Market Value vs. Appraised Value | Oakridge Real Estate

Market Value Vs. Appraised Value

Market value and appraised value are both important factors to consider when buying or selling a home. The market value is the estimated price that a buyer would be willing to pay for the property, based on current market conditions. The appraised value is the estimated value of the property as determined by a licensed appraiser. Lenders use the appraised value to determine how much they are willing to lend for the purchase of the home. Both values can impact the price negotiations during a home sale, and it's important to take both into consideration when making a decision.

Market Value: The price a buyer is will to pay for a property.
